The more modern method of chip calorimetry by Flash DSC is also demonstrated.\n\nThermosets are polymers that have undergone a permanent chemical reaction known as curing or crosslinking to form a giant crosslinked network structure. They are rigid, typically insoluble materials of high mechanical strength and high temperature stability, with a broad range of applications that benefit from these properties. In contrast to thermoplastics, thermosets cannot be remelted or remolded into another shape after curing.","brand":"Andreas Bach","offers":[{"title":"Default Title","offer_id":53645709836615,"sku":"9781569903421","price":159.99,"currency_code":"EUR","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0920\/5455\/2903\/files\/thermal-analysis-of-thermosets-ebook-cover.webp?v=1775243931"},{"product_id":"zno-tetrapods-ebook","title":"ZnO Tetrapods","description":"\u003cp\u003eThis book highlights recent trends and results based on the focused investigations on zinc oxide tetrapods, a specific morphology of ZnO with intriguing structural and optoelectronic features viable for several novel applications. Lerma Valero","offers":[{"title":"Default Title","offer_id":53647357641031,"sku":"9781569909423","price":119.99,"currency_code":"EUR","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0920\/5455\/2903\/files\/scientific-injection-molding-tools-ebook-cover.webp?v=1775261607"},{"product_id":"rheology-of-plastics-thomas-schroeder-ebook","title":"Rheology of Plastics","description":"Rheology describes the flow and deformation of materials. Plastics in particular are characterized by their special flow behavior. The viscosity of plastics is not only dependent on temperature and pressure, but also on the flow velocity. This flow behavior, known as structural viscosity, is clearly described in this textbook. In addition, due to their molecular chain structure, plastics have visco-elastic properties that affect the flow processes.
